MSIGen
MSIGen processes and visualizes mass spectrometry imaging (MSI) data to support multiple acquisition modes—including MS^1, MS^2, MS^3, multiple-reaction monitoring (MRM)-MSI, and ion mobility spectrometry (IMS)-MSI—to improve molecular specificity and sensitivity.
Key Features:
- Support for Multiple Acquisition Modes: Handles MS^1, MS^2, MS^3, MRM‑MSI, and IMS‑MSI acquisition modes to enhance molecular specificity, distinguish isobaric and isomeric species, and improve sensitivity for low-abundance molecules.
- Line-Wise Data Acquisition: Processes line-wise MSI data acquired by continuous scanning along parallel lines to capture detailed spatial information across samples.
- Targeted Ion Image Extraction and Normalization: Performs targeted extraction of ion images and applies normalization procedures to ensure data consistency across experiments.
- Visualization and Export: Generates ion images and publication-quality figures and supports exportation of results as images, arrays, or publication-ready visuals.
- Vendor-Neutral Format Support: Accommodates multiple vendor-specific and open-source MSI data formats to maintain compatibility across different instrumentation.
Scientific Applications:
- Spatial molecular localization: Enables mapping of molecular distributions within complex samples to study spatial heterogeneity.
- Enhanced molecular specificity and sensitivity studies: Supports experiments using tandem MS, MRM, or IMS to resolve isobaric/isomeric species and detect low-abundance analytes.
- Sample types: Applicable to imaging of biological tissues, pharmaceutical compound distributions, and environmental sample analyses.
Methodology:
MSIGen processes MSI data using a Python-based architecture, incorporates advanced signal processing techniques to generate ion images, and applies normalization procedures to ensure consistency across experiments.
